UNODC teams have collated epidemiological data and, where necessary, carried out assessments of IDUs' access to components of the UNAIDS comprehensive package. For example, blind or low-vision colleagues and members of the public wont be able to access the information in a PDF file if the document hasnt been made accessible. This principle is known as Inclusive Design; we create products, services, and environments without the need for special adaptation or specialized design. Section 240 of the ADA Standards (F240 in the ABA Standards) establishes the scoping requirements for "accessible" play components. Major components such as Calendar and Modal are still lacking in their accessibility out-of-the-box Some overuse or misuse of ARIA on a few components Various components have the ability to customize to a point where you can turn off certain features; in general, these should not be used because they will limit the accessibility of your content To do so has firm benefitsnotably better designs for all. Components Accordion Create accessible accordions without Webflow Interactions. In macOS, open System Preferences, then click Accessibility (or Universal Access in older versions). How do you resolve accessibility issues? Individually accessible elements and components are part of building accessible products. Without it, functional and technical accessibility are largely redundant. Part 3: Striving for Accessibility When Building Components for a CMS Written by Alexander Dubovoy in Foundations on April 26, 2022 Next.js Accessibility In part one of this series, we learned that accessibility is about preventing disability-based discrimination against people who visit our websites. Robust - Content must be robust enough that it can be interpreted reliably by a wide variety of user agents, including assistive technology (as technologies and user agents evolve, the content should remain accessible). According to Microsofts Inclusive Design Toolkit, each year in the U.S., approximately 26,000 new people suffer the loss of an upper limb. It provides developers the ability to create complex and reusable custom elements, which can be used in HTML much like any standard element. Web browsers provide support for keyboard interactions so that users who don't use a mouse can use a keyboard to navigate the user interface and perform actions in SharePoint. Accessible UI Components The most popular usecase for Web Components is probably that of creating custom user interface controls. This is a guide to better understand the role of each:Emotional accessibility is the first impression a person experiences when presented with a service or product. Official websites use .gov When web browsers, media players, assistive technologies, and other user agents support an accessibility feature, users are more likely to demand it and developers are more likely to implement it in their content. Select a Simulator as the target, and click Run button. They're all based on the latest SLDS component blueprints, which follow the relevant accessibility guidelines. 206.2.17.1 Ground Level and Elevated Play Components. Accessibility is the concept of whether a product or service can be used by everyonehowever they encounter it. PUXL framework: Build the accessible Web. Image by Michael Duffy, from: Essential Components of Web Accessibility. WCAG 2.0 refers to Web Content Accessibility Guidelines, which are published by the World Wide Web Consortium's (W3C) Web Accessibility Initiative (WAI). Refresh the page, check Medium 's site status, or find. Accessibility Statement. A fully accessible autocomplete JavaScript component that follows WAI-ARIA best practices. Accessibility The Department of Homeland Security (DHS) is committed to providing accessible Information and Communication Technology (ICT) to individuals with disabilities, including members of the public and federal employees, by meeting or exceeding the requirements of Section 508 of the Rehabilitation Act of 1973, as amended (29 U.S.C. As an example, imagine that three people are trying to watch the same video, but each person has a different type of disability: The fix that benefits everyone in this circumstance might be to apply a captioning service to the video. For some situations, accessibility requirements are imposed by law. "Those components are . This will ensure that youre not only following legal requirements, but making your product or service more usable for everyone. These components allow the Accessibility Manager to keep track of every component active on the screen. Both a link and a button are accessible for people relying on keyboard-only navigation; it can be clickable with both mouse and keys, and it can be tabbed between using the tab key on the keyboard. Created by Graphic artist: Michael Duffy. This is known as the Curb-cut effect. When we design for people with permanent disabilities, folks with temporary and situational limitations can also benefit. Join DigitalGovs Communities of Practice to connect with over 13,000 people across 27 focus areas who learn, share, and collaborate to build solutions to common problems and challenges in government. A brief overview of CoreUI for Vue features and limitations for the creation of accessible content. We can broadly divide it into three pillars: emotional, functional and technical. Each is based on testing with users, UX and design needs of past projects, and from following W3C specifications & notes. Components Modal Create accessible modal popups easily on Webflow. According to the World Health Organization, 2.2 billion people in the world are visually impaired.These 285 million people still need access to the Internet, and deserve to have access to the . Accessibility in components. It provides developers the ability to create complex and reusable custom elements, which can be used in HTML much like any standard element. Today, accessibility is built-in to our core features like document libraries, lists and pages. Enable the Accessibility Scanner from Android Settings > Accessibility > Accessibility Scanner > On. Let's take a look at how to locate these features for your device. People who have difficulty reading are said to have a . As we design experiences, we ought to remember that the internet is a part of everybody's lives, including those who are visually impaired or blind.. Functional accessibility defines whether a service or product is designed in such a way that a person can easily understand and manage it. SharePoint supports the accessibility features of common web browsers to enable you to access and manage SharePoint sites. Components don't give the user the full WYSIWYG experience, but they do allow users to add complicated content to the page without requiring an understanding of the underlying markup. Accessible Web Components Understandable - Information and the operation of user interface must be understandable (the content or operation cannot be beyond their understanding). It isn't creative like CSS, or energetic like JavaScript, but it quietly teams up with the browser to make a lot of the web work - much . If one component has poor accessibility support, sometimes other components can compensate through work-arounds that require much more effort and are not good for accessibility overall. Screen-reader optimization: The AI runs in the background and learns the website's components from top to bottom, thereby providing screen-readers with meaningful data using the ARIA set of attributes. Subscribe to our weekly newslettera round-up of innovative work, news, and ideas from people and teams across government. The classic example is to replace the native HTML Select element. Lets review temporary and situational disabilities in a bit more detail. Then there are people using your website in non-optimal situations - they have an injury like a broken arm, or in a poorly-lit environment. U.S. General Services Administration. ADF renders accessible content to the extent listed in this ACR, when an application developer uses it according to guidance provided in the reference manual . Now, you might already have some experience with accessibility, but other people that you work with might be new to the topic, or need methods or tools to see how to improve the accessibility of a product or service. 1 revision Pages 12. In order to be an advocate for the creation of products and services that are accessible, we need to reframe our ideas around disability. The one that we use most often for hosting meetings is Relay Conference Captioning (RCC). We are going to look a few ways to make your react applications more accessible. Accessible UI Components For The Web | by Addy Osmani |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. VoiceOver uses accessibility information from onscreen elements to help people understand the location of each element and what it can do. # Accessibility Attributes. Looking for U.S. government information and services? Making components accessible is difficult and requires more specialized knowledge. Accessibility of Web Components @MarcySutton / Substantial Slide 1 Slide 2 Slide 3 Slide 4 However, it's a good idea to address accessibility issues regardless of . They have a, Sam is struggling to listen to a video in a loud office. Developing a strong understanding of the people who use your products is one of the more effective ways of ensuring that the decisions you make about your product directly impact the people on the other end. Improving Angular Component's accessibility | by Emma Twersky | Angular Blog Write Sign up Sign In 500 Apologies, but something went wrong on our end. To give this button a value, we need to tell assistive technologies that it is closed. An official website of the United States government. It becomes normal.. WCAG provides recommendations for making digital content more accessible. Does the user of a product experience limitations in accessing the product because of inherent faults in the product? Technical accessibility refers to physical and software products that are engineered in such a way that they can fulfill the functional accessibility expectations. code or markup that defines structure, presentation, etc. When developers want to implement an accessibility feature in their, When an accessibility feature is implemented in, developers can do more work to compensate for some lack of accessibility support in authoring tools; for example, coding markup directly instead of through a tool, users can do more work to compensate for some lack of accessibility support in browsers, media players, and assistive technology and lack of accessibility of content; for example, using different browsers or assistive technologies to overcome different accessibility issues. Accessible software and assistive technologies enable users with disabilities to use the products you build. All components come with proper attributes and keyboard interactions out of the box. It is essential that several different components of web development and interaction work together in order for the web to be accessible to people with disabilities. Use proper roles and relevant aria-* attributes. We also have to accept that accessibility can never be perfect but it can be optimal. Emma Twersky 1.2K Followers Follow More from Medium Rebai Ahmed in Level Up Coding Accessibility means different things to different people but accessibility is not just a single thing. The principle of the three pillars of accessibility can be applied to any type of work and is not limited to a specific industry. Each pillar must be accessible in itself but all must be considered together. Its important to understand that everyone experiences some form of disability. GitHub, Around one in five users have a disability. Add a new npm package. WCAG 2.0 outlines the principles, guidelines, testable success criteria, and techniques needed to optimize content. The idea that things that help people with disabilities can benefit everyone inspired the field of universal design, where buildings and objects are designed to be as usable as possible for everyone, regardless of age or ability. Take advantage of the accessibility features in Microsoft Teams for a better meeting or live event experience Make your content accessible to everyone with the Accessibility Checker Share slides in a Teams meeting with PowerPoint Live Add alt text to visuals in chat messages in Make your content accessible to everyone with the Accessibility Checker It helps your team share . One key aspect of the accessibility of UI controls is that by default, browsers allow them to be manipulated by the keyboard. These components include: Web developers usually use authoring tools and evaluation tools to create web content. Establish accessibility requirements early in your project lifecycle, ensuring each team member knows their responsibility, and keeping the team accountable for building accessible products. Please share your ideas, suggestions, or comments via e-mail to the publicly-archived list wai@w3.org or via GitHub. The Angular team provides tools to make it easier to create Accessible Components, and now it's time for developers to utilize them and create accessible Angular applications. While each component has been built with some default styling, the library is composed to allow easy restyling, using the same CSS that you use for the rest of your web site. w3.org/WAI/fundamentals/components/ Color adjustments - users can select various color contrast profiles such as light, dark, inverted and monochrome. non-sighted, myopia, color blindness, etc.) Oops! The plugin works by attaching an accessibility component to all relevant UI elements in the scene. Examples include a new parent holding a baby, someone trying to open a door while holding one or multiple items, or if calling into meeting where they have a visual presentation. Accessibility of a web component is the assumption that the component is available and usable to all. Standards and Guidelines WCAG The most popular usecase for Web Components is probably that of creating custom user interface controls. HTML attributes describe the UI elements that they contain. Include the artist credit, editor, and copyright reference in any published or posted material: Customize Components. Published on 19/04/2020. To learn more about an individual control/component's accessibility compliance, click the name of the control/component. For iOS: Open the iOS folder of your Flutter app in Xcode. Additionally, sometimes poor accessibility support in one component cannot be reasonably overcome by other components and the result is inaccessibility, making it impossible for some people with disabilities to use a particular website, page, or feature. This process ends up in making the apps non-accessible. Join 60,000 others in government and subscribe to our newsletter a round-up of the best digital news in government and across our field. Creating a digital service experiencea UX case study, Photoshop Auxiliary tools for easier document workPhotovideotutorials. Emotional accessibility and acceptance is a crucial incentive for the person to engage with the service or product. Use the preview packages. Google defines accessibility as below. Accessibility means different things to different people but accessibility is not just a single thing. It provides the foundation for understanding the different accessibility standards developed by the W3C Web Accessibility Initiative (WAI). Jobs by vuejobs.com. Situational disabilities There are also situational disabilities that occur during specific circumstances. Here are some of the interface's capabilities: Font adjustments - users can increase and decrease its size, change its family (type), adjust the spacing, alignment, line height, and more. . Tip: Use Bit to build React apps faster with components. Introduction. You can try this out using our native-keyboard-accessibility.html example (see the source code ). However, in most cases the works-arounds are not implemented and the result is still poor accessibility. Here are some practices for being more inclusive with those you work with, many of which are an extension of the courtesy that most people automatically practice. Accessible. To load one of these components, include the component name in the load array of the loader block of your MathJax configuration. Components. There are three levels of conformance to aim for accessibility guidelines. Create accessible modal popups easily on Webflow. For the person who isnt able to do something, its this mismatch that impairs an individual. Accessible Web Components are built to be reactive and communicate changes to their internal state via events. Build beautiful, usable products faster. It includes a list of the upcoming community events and training aimed at elevating your digital expertise. At least one accessible route shall be provided within the play area. To inject axe, simply invoke the cy.injectAxe command. The GOV.UK Design System team wants as many people as possible to be able to use this website. React fully supports building accessible websites, often by using standard HTML techniques. Definition of done. a11y/complexity. The three pillars of accessibility. Reakit is built with composition in mind. How to use VoiceOver screen reader on a Mac (macOS) , How to use VoiceOver screen reader on a Mac (iOS) , How to use Narrator screen reader on a PC (Windows 10) , How to use Narrator screen reader on a PC (Windows 7 and 8.1) , How to use open source NVDA screen reader on a PC , How to use TalkBack screen reader on a Android , Eight Principles of Mobile-Friendliness: Accessibility, W3Cs Web Accessibility Initiative (WAI) perspective videos, they also have a full site about Inclusive Design, Web Almanac, Part II, Chapter 8: Accessibility, Cognitive, Learning, and Neurological Disabilities, Federal Leadership and Professional Development, Mark lost most of his hearing after a severe illness. React web accessibility checklist. Refresh the page, check Medium 's site status, or find something interesting to read. Increment and decrement (+ and -) counter in a Webflow Form. It is clickable. As developers we often forget what all is. LEVEL A - Fulfils the basic requirements LEVEL AA- Best suited for websites, covers most of the accessibility barriers LEVEL AAA - Desired level, but almost unachievable for websites - Level AA usually will suffice for a commercial website. Here are some tasks for each member of your team: Create an environment where folks feel comfortable letting you know what their preferences are so that every team member can contribute in their full capacity. Sometimes the technical descriptions of the WCAG requirements can make it harder to understand, but luckily we have the resources to help navigate the basics. Web accessibility (also known as a11y) refers to the practice of creating websites that can be used by anyone be that a person with a disability, a slow connection, outdated or broken hardware or simply someone in an unfavorable environment. Part of the beauty of Web Components is that it's a supported standard. Ensures dynamic attributes are updated and elements are keyboard actionable. This command will make the test fail when it uncovers accessibility issues. Anything that makes a website more accessible will make it more usable. Under Section 508 of the Rehabilitation Act of 1973, agencies must give disabled employees and members of the public access to information that is comparable to the access available to others. On mobile devices that use Android or iOS, open the Settings app, then . a11y/explorer. Strategies, standards, and supporting resources to make the Web accessible to people with disabilities. Q.3 Explain the purpose of Accessibility testing. Follow the @ReadabilityGrp for regular insights and discussions about accessibility in typography. 2022, Source code available on Your submission has been received! Accessibility, then, refers to the experience of users who might be . lock ( a11y/semantic-enrich. To be fully compliant with accessibility standards, include alt text and a complete transcript of audio and video content on your site. We work on projects where people might be in uncomfortable situations and they need to ask for government services. Temporary disabilities There are occasions where folks might have a temporary disability due to an illness or medical circumstances. By presenting a form to the user, the content can be limited to very specific requirements and even validated . Build a custom Range Slider Form component, Use a Webflow Dropdown element as a Webflow Form